Brokers Expect Business Improvement
In a recent survey, over 70% of real estate brokerage leaders anticipate increased transaction volumes in 2025, marking a significant rise in optimism compared to previous years. Additionally, 63% expect greater profitability, the highest level in three years. This positive outlook is attributed to a belief that the real estate market has reached its lowest point and is poised for recovery.
Despite this optimism, brokerage leaders identify challenges ahead, including agent recruitment, declining profit margins, and technology adoption. Notably, while industry executives express increased confidence in the U.S. economy, consumer sentiment remains low, with concerns about inflation and economic policies.
